Job Description:
The ERP Systems Analyst will support various applications at different sites within the Business Unit, including but not limited to ERP, Quality Systems, and Salesforce. The systems analyst will support IT applications, ensure compliance with regulatory and corporate requirements, and support the company's strategic goals through effective IT management.
Key Responsibilities
- Experience with Dynamics AX 2012, Dynamics 365
- Experience migrating to newer version of software or moving to new ERP system following compliance guidelines
- Database updates using MSSQL queries, procedures, jobs
- Provide software support for ERP (manufacturing a must), Document Management, EDI, Quality Systems, CRM, and Other Software Applications.
- Ensure adherence to SOX compliance.
- Assist in automation using corporate-approved tools.
- Involvement in new software projects: eCommerce SAP, QT9 (QMS system), SAP S4 HANA.
- Create and update reporting using SSRS, Crystal reports, SQL Views, and Power BI
- Manage disaster recovery for critical systems (ERP).
- Research, recommend, and implement process improvements.
- Conduct annual attestation to IT policies and procedures, ensuring SOX compliance.
- Submit quarterly IT-CMS attestation to system changes (reporting objects, system updates).
- Ensure adherence to systems quality compliance.
- Serve as backup for the Help Desk support queue (hardware, software).
